中文摘要:
      以ProE软件为平台,研究了复杂形状容器的体积与高度的变化规律,并以食用油桶为例,利用ProE行为建模模块中的“UDA”分析功能、Pro/Program 模块中的程序编辑以及曲面模块,在容器表面智能化地刻制3D刻度线以及标示容积大小的3D文字,有效地解决了容器容积的标示问题,保证了容器容积的标示精度,提高了刻度容器的设计与加工的效率。该方法可应用于复杂容器容积的计算和刻度线的设计制作。
英文摘要:
      The changing rule of vessel's volume with correspondence high of complex containers was studied using ProE software. Edible oil drum was taken as example. The vessel volume indication method has solved effectively with the UDA analysis function in ProE behavior modeling module, the surface module formidable function and procedure edition function in the Pro/Program to intellectually mark 3D volume's scale as well as indication volume 3D character in the vessel surface. This can guarantee volume precision and enhance efficiency of vessel design. The method can be widely applied in complex vessel volume computation, scale division line design and manufacture.
